In 1754, JAMES JENNIUS Hulsey entered the world in Goochland, Virginia, USA, born to Charles Hulsey And Hannah Witt Hulsey. JAMES JENNIUS Hulsey married Anne, and had children including Adam Hulsey, Anny Hulsey, Charles Micajah Hulsey, Daughter Hulsey, Elizabeth Hulsey, James Adler Hulsey, Joel H Hulsey, John Hulsey, Miss Hulsey, Pleasant Wesley Hulsey, William Hulsey. JAMES JENNIUS Hulsey passed away in 1827 in Gainesville, Hall County, Georgia, United States of America.
